  Ephemerides of the Largest Asteroids
Initial ephemerides were constructed and the difference between the a priori error and the actual root-mean-square error for each logical group was examined to determine the adjustment in the error.
Iterating with a new ephemerides calculated using the new root-mean-square errors was possible, but in all cases a single iteration was sufficient to determine the root-mean-square error of the observations.
The planetary model used to determine the ephemerides of the asteroids is the JPL ephemeris DE405.

 JPL Planetary And Lunar Ephemerides On CD-ROM
These allow a competent user to obtain the rectangular coordinates of the sun, moon, and nine major planets by means of a subroutine written in standard fortran.
Available Ephemerides ========================== DE200 : (includes nutations but not librations) JED 2305424.5 (1599 DEC 09) to JED 2513360.5 (2169 MAR 31) This ephemeris has been the basis of the Astronomical Almanac since 1984.

 C source code for JPL DE ephemerides
Those looking for more information as to the inner workings of DE ephemerides, as well as how to convert their raw output into useful positions, may be interested in the book Fundamental Ephemeris Computations, by Paul J. Heafner, published by Willmann-Bell.
The full ephemerides tend to be large (DE-406 runs to about 200 MBytes), but as you'll see, "subset" ephemerides are available covering shorter spans.
That is, one might use the code to open up a DE ephemeris (of any of the three flavors), and ask that a smaller ephemeris covering a particular time span be written out, in any of the three flavors.

 Minor Planet & Comet Ephemeris Service
To allow an observer to get ephemerides (utilizing the latest published elements) and/or elements for an arbitrary set of (up to 100 at a time) minor planets or comets.
To allow an observer to prepare an HTML document that can be placed on their own website, with the aim of encouraging others to perform follow-up astrometry of their minor planet discoveries.
By default, ephemerides are geocentric, begin now and are for 20 days at 1 day intervals.
